Анотація
В статті розглянуто аспекти впливу офшорного банківського бізнесу на міжнародний банківський бізнес в цілому,
аналіз проблеми «витоку капіталу» з України. Думки більшості сучасних економістів сходяться сьогодні у тому, що
лібералізація міжнародної торгівлі є необхідним напрямком розвитку світової економіки. Доведено, що вірогідність
офшорного банківського бізнесу пояснюється можливістю уникнути оподаткування фізичних та юридичних осіб, обійти
чисельні обмеження ділових операцій та наявність конфіденційності.
The article considers aspects of the influence of offshore banking business on the international banking business as a wholе, analysis of the problem of "leakage of capital" from Ukraine. The views of most contemporary economists today agree that the liberalization of international trade is a necessary direction for the development of the world economy. It is proved that the probability of offshore banking business is explained by the possibility to avoid taxation of individuals and legal entities, to circumvent the numerous restrictions on business operations and the availability of confidentiality. Legal tax planning is not just well-adjusted accounting and proper compilation of balance sheets, but it also has the legal ability or not to pay any taxes in general, or to reduce their level to the minimum. Therefore, "offshore" (from the English offshore - "off-shore", "abroad") - this is one of the most famous methods of tax planning. It is based on the laws of many countries, which partially or completely exempt companies owned by individuals, but provided that the company does not have any income in that country, and the owners and management are not residents of the country. The problem of "leakage of capital" is by far the decisive factor for the Ukrainian economy. The "leakage of capital" is a phenomenon that is inherent not only for the Ukrainian economy. An important element of currency control is the control not only of economic entities, but also directly on the channels of "capital leakage" and of the institutions through which this "turn" is carried out. Implementation of economic reforms in Ukraine, the formation of a new system of state regulation of the Ukrainian economy, financial and banking spheres in general and the domestic currency market, in particular, all of this significantly lagged behind the pace of liberalization of these spheres. The consequence was that capital from the country began to be exported not so much in violation of the law, but bypassing the current legislative and regulatory norms, that is, in legal or legal forms, which are possible due to gaps in the legislation. Given the shortage of foreign exchange funds needed to service external liabilities and pay for investment imports, "capital flight" can become a major factor. For Ukraine, faced with the task of finding additional development resources, the problem of "capital leakage" has two aspects. One concerns the reduction of the volume of "capital leakage", and the second - the return of funds, which during the decade was withdrawn from the monetary circulation of the country. The outflow becomes an independent factor in the destruction of economic potential. The outflow of the largest part of currency funds was caused by non-return of export currency earnings, non-receipt of goods and services for repayment of advance payments for imports. The situation in which Ukraine has appeared in recent years, requires the adoption of immediate decisions. In general, the most attractive for Ukraine is the institutional system of currency control, which is based on the central bank and executive authorities.
